ABSTRACT:
A spacer for interposition between adjacent balls in a ball bearing assembly is provided comprising a thermoplastically molded body having a cylindrical periphery and oppositely disposed ball engaging sides. An internal reinforcement disc formed from a material having a high specific heat is molded into the body. The internal reinforcement disc includes a circumferential flange that provides an initial compressive prestress on the thermoplastically molded body.
